Transaction 7576dbc4777ae1a8d110ac58424a42bb3e9448694fa13f999f7e34953731eba9
1 Input
1 Output
-
7576dbc4777ae1a8d110ac58424a42bb3e9448694fa13f999f7e34953731eba9:0
- value
- 52480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 427817a97ec6cd4301a714ae1b24c5cb27a588a9 OP_EQUAL
- address
- 37kUPNadnMLGj1JZcs97C9uGDdHaYDHTLf